Output 768da7ef136dcdbfaa5623834582e2b92879aec1666e128da1ce1818695b00be:60

value
2327
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c260896aca340e44117549ae028ae298cf1f313a704b7e96670b56f39d55894a
address
bc1pcfsgj6k2xs8ygyt4fxhq9zhznr837vf6wp9ha9n8pdt08824399q5uhg2e
transaction
768da7ef136dcdbfaa5623834582e2b92879aec1666e128da1ce1818695b00be
confirmations
121721
spent
true